Skip to main content

Retrieve scientific papers and manage associated citations.

Project description

https://readthedocs.org/projects/franklin/badge/?version=latest https://travis-ci.com/canismarko/franklin.svg?branch=master https://coveralls.io/repos/github/canismarko/franklin/badge.svg?branch=master https://badge.fury.io/py/franklin.svg

franklin is a set of tools for accessing research articles and their associated bibtex references.

The following console scripts are available.

  • fetch-doi - Retrieve PDFs and bibtex entries.

  • abbreviate-journals - Parse a bibtex file and look up abbreviated journal names.

  • bibtex-cleanup - [coming soon] Parse a bibtex file and clean it up.

Development

For development, a developer installation through pip is recommended.

$ git fetch https://github.com/canismarko/franklin.git
$ pip install franklin/requirements.txt
$ pip install -e franklin/

Run the tests using pytest:

$ pytest

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

franklin-0.14.tar.gz (33.6 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

franklin-0.14-py3-none-any.whl (30.6 kB view details)

Uploaded Python 3

File details

Details for the file franklin-0.14.tar.gz.

File metadata

  • Download URL: franklin-0.14.tar.gz
  • Upload date:
  • Size: 33.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.12.2

File hashes

Hashes for franklin-0.14.tar.gz
Algorithm Hash digest
SHA256 02b9888ca351d8a175e6c570853f9cdc7684e57a16b4047ab8710754e4d7eac1
MD5 caaf39c7db52a3c48098997040a4f098
BLAKE2b-256 76fc7342f3719f1c9528bdafd08dce16b2f0f3aa19fdf6a7d3e6a3fb02f0ff4c

See more details on using hashes here.

File details

Details for the file franklin-0.14-py3-none-any.whl.

File metadata

  • Download URL: franklin-0.14-py3-none-any.whl
  • Upload date:
  • Size: 30.6 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.12.2

File hashes

Hashes for franklin-0.14-py3-none-any.whl
Algorithm Hash digest
SHA256 1c15d79f8970557e19d173af3c42b54f37ed133da533e328f2af870217b75e8d
MD5 13971bd6302b348621a24101f065799a
BLAKE2b-256 55eff03820270f7f53f78ab5e7ca18668a40190051aec1235c27a59ffb8929a5

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page